Vipin Kumar

Researcher at University of Minnesota

Publications -  678
Citations -  67181

Vipin Kumar is an academic researcher from University of Minnesota. The author has contributed to research in topics: Parallel algorithm & Computer science. The author has an hindex of 95, co-authored 614 publications receiving 59034 citations. Previous affiliations of Vipin Kumar include University of Maryland, College Park & United States Department of the Army.

Scalability of Parallel Algorithms for Matrix Multiplication

TL;DR: This paper analyzes the performance and scalability of a number of parallel formulations of the matrix multiplication algorithm and predicts the conditions under which each formulation is better than the others.

Performance properties of large scale parallel systems

TL;DR: The impact of parallel processing overheads and the degree of concurrency of a parallel algorithm on the optimal number of processors to be used when the criterion for optimality is minimization of the parallel execution time is studied.

Clustering in a High-Dimensional Space Using Hypergraph Models

TL;DR: The proposed method for clustering of data in a high dimensional space based on a hypergraph model performed much better than traditional schemes for high dimensional data sets in terms of quality of clusters and runtime and was able to filter out noise data from the clusters very effectively without compromising the quality of the clusters.
